#1c7211 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c7211 is composed of 11% red, 44.7%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.1%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 113.2 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 25.7%. #1c7211 color hex could be obtained by blending #38e422 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#1c7211 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c7211 has RGB values of R:28, G:114,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1864209.

Shades and Tints of #1c7211
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c02 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c7211
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f453e is the less saturated color, while #108102 is the most saturated one.
